Sample data lets you explore MindSalt before entering your organization's information.
Add sample data during set up #
- Sign in as the account owner or a system administrator who can manage account set up.
- Open the set up wizard from Home.
- Select Populate with sample data.
- Wait for MindSalt to finish creating the demo records.
- Select Start exploring.
The sample-data option is intended for new trial accounts. It may disappear after set up is complete or after the account begins using real data.
Explore the sample account #
Use the demo records to review:
- client, project, and task relationships,
- time and expense entry,
- approval workflows when enabled,
- dashboards and reports,
- and the difference between employee and administrator views.
Avoid editing sample records into real company records. Create separate production records after the evaluation is complete.
Remove sample data #
- Open Admin, then Subscription.
- Find the sample-data cleanup option.
- Open the removal preview.
- Review every record type and count shown.
- Confirm removal only when the preview contains MindSalt-created demo data.
- Refresh the application and verify that the demo clients, projects, time, and expenses are gone.
Some trial configurations also show the cleanup option in General settings. Review the preview before confirming.
Warning: Sample-data removal is destructive. It is not a general-purpose cleanup tool and should not be used when the preview includes production records or when you are unsure how a record was created.
Continue with real set up #
After removing the sample data:
- Confirm company, timezone, currency, and terminology settings.
- Create employees and assign security roles.
- Create clients, projects, and tasks.
- Configure time, expenses, and approvals as needed.
- Ask a small group of users to test time entry, expenses, and approvals before rollout.
